Glioblastoma multiforme and meningioma in the same patient - a case report
Jan Fortuniak1, Dariusz J Jaskólski, Marek Zawirski
1Department of Neurosurgery, Medical University of Lodz, Lodz, Poland. jfort@esculap.pl
Abstract:
We describe a case of a 64-year-old female who presented with concurrent left parietal glioblastoma multiforme and left occipital parasagittal meningioma. Both lesions were excised during the operation. There was no clinical evidence of phacomatosis. Aetiological and clinical aspects of the phenomenon are discussed.
